Subject: [GIT PULL] small perf fix for v3.0-rc1


Linus,

Please pull the latest perf-urgent-for-linus git tree from:

   git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/tip/linux-2.6-tip.git perf-urgent-for-linus

I kept this one really simple, because AFAICS this is the first ever 
3.0 pull request sent to you on lkml, and i do not want to go down in 
history as the idiot who sent the first broken tree to you in this 
new and exciting 3.0 kernel age! ;-)

 Thanks,

	Ingo

------------------>
Steven Rostedt (1):
      x86: Put back -pg to tsc.o and add no GCOV to vread_tsc_64.o


 arch/x86/kernel/Makefile |    2 ++
 1 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 0 deletions(-)

diff --git a/arch/x86/kernel/Makefile b/arch/x86/kernel/Makefile
index f5abe3a..90b06d4 100644
--- a/arch/x86/kernel/Makefile
+++ b/arch/x86/kernel/Makefile
@@ -8,6 +8,7 @@ CPPFLAGS_vmlinux.lds += -U$(UTS_MACHINE)
 
 ifdef CONFIG_FUNCTION_TRACER
 # Do not profile debug and lowlevel utilities
+CFLAGS_REMOVE_tsc.o = -pg
 CFLAGS_REMOVE_rtc.o = -pg
 CFLAGS_REMOVE_paravirt-spinlocks.o = -pg
 CFLAGS_REMOVE_pvclock.o = -pg
@@ -28,6 +29,7 @@ CFLAGS_paravirt.o	:= $(nostackp)
 GCOV_PROFILE_vsyscall_64.o	:= n
 GCOV_PROFILE_hpet.o		:= n
 GCOV_PROFILE_tsc.o		:= n
+GCOV_PROFILE_vread_tsc_64.o	:= n
 GCOV_PROFILE_paravirt.o		:= n
 
 # vread_tsc_64 is hot and should be fully optimized:
